
Reception / Pre-school · Pre-K / Kindergarten · ages 3–5
FOR
Children in Reception, nursery and pre-school (ages 3–5) learning to count with one-to-one correspondence — the single most important early-maths skill before number recognition or addition.
WHAT’S INSIDE
• Cover, how-to-use guide and a printable ‘counting principles’ poster
• ‘Touch and count’ sheets — sets of 1, 2, 3, 4 and 5 (then 6–10)
• ‘How many?’ matching-to-numeral pages
• ‘Count and circle’ pages (with deliberate distractors)
• Subitising flash cards (1–5) — printable
• ‘One more, one less’ early-number sense pages
• Assessment checklist mapped to ELG: Number
• Teacher and parent guidance notes
